大型网络服务器平台有哪些,大型网络服务器平台概述,架构、功能与关键技术解析
- 综合资讯
- 2024-10-19 00:24:36
- 0
大型网络服务器平台主要包括云平台、大数据平台、物联网平台等。它们具备强大的计算、存储和数据处理能力,支持高并发访问。平台架构通常包括计算节点、存储节点和网络节点,功能涵...
大型网络服务器平台主要包括云平台、大数据平台、物联网平台等。它们具备强大的计算、存储和数据处理能力,支持高并发访问。平台架构通常包括计算节点、存储节点和网络节点,功能涵盖虚拟化、自动化、高可用性和安全性等。关键技术包括分布式计算、存储虚拟化、负载均衡和网络安全等。
随着互联网技术的飞速发展,大型网络服务器平台在保障网络稳定运行、提升服务质量等方面发挥着至关重要的作用,本文将详细介绍大型网络服务器平台的架构、功能以及关键技术,以期为相关从业人员提供有益的参考。
大型网络服务器平台架构
1、分布式架构
分布式架构是大型网络服务器平台的核心架构,它将服务器资源进行分散部署,以提高系统的可扩展性、可用性和容错性,分布式架构主要包括以下几个层次:
(1)物理层:包括服务器、存储设备、网络设备等硬件资源。
(2)网络层:负责数据传输,包括交换机、路由器、防火墙等网络设备。
(3)数据层:包括数据库、缓存、文件系统等数据存储和处理设备。
(4)应用层:负责业务逻辑处理,包括各种应用服务器、中间件等。
2、微服务架构
微服务架构是近年来兴起的一种新型架构,它将应用拆分成多个独立、可扩展的微服务,以实现高可用性和易维护性,微服务架构在大型网络服务器平台中的应用主要体现在以下几个方面:
(1)服务拆分:将复杂的业务拆分成多个独立的微服务,提高系统的可维护性和可扩展性。
(2)服务注册与发现:通过服务注册中心实现微服务的自动注册和发现,简化服务调用过程。
(3)负载均衡:采用负载均衡技术,将请求分配到不同的微服务实例,提高系统吞吐量。
大型网络服务器平台功能
1、高并发处理
大型网络服务器平台应具备高并发处理能力,以满足海量用户同时访问的需求,主要技术包括:
(1)多线程:采用多线程技术,提高并发处理能力。
(2)异步处理:采用异步处理技术,减少线程阻塞,提高系统吞吐量。
(3)消息队列:采用消息队列技术,实现消息的异步传输和处理。
2、高可用性
大型网络服务器平台应具备高可用性,以保证系统在发生故障时能够快速恢复,主要技术包括:
(1)故障转移:在主节点发生故障时,自动将服务切换到备用节点。
(2)负载均衡:通过负载均衡技术,实现服务的均匀分配,降低单点故障风险。
(3)数据备份:定期对数据进行备份,防止数据丢失。
3、安全性
大型网络服务器平台应具备安全性,以保障用户数据的安全和隐私,主要技术包括:
(1)访问控制:采用访问控制技术,限制用户对系统资源的访问。
(2)数据加密:对敏感数据进行加密,防止数据泄露。
(3)入侵检测:采用入侵检测技术,及时发现并阻止恶意攻击。
大型网络服务器平台关键技术
1、云计算技术
云计算技术为大型网络服务器平台提供了强大的计算和存储资源,提高了系统的可扩展性和灵活性,主要技术包括:
(1)虚拟化技术:通过虚拟化技术,实现资源的动态分配和优化。
(2)容器技术:采用容器技术,简化应用部署和运维。
(3)分布式存储:采用分布式存储技术,提高数据存储的可靠性和性能。
2、大数据处理技术
大数据处理技术为大型网络服务器平台提供了高效的数据处理能力,以支持海量数据的存储、分析和挖掘,主要技术包括:
(1)分布式计算:采用分布式计算技术,实现海量数据的并行处理。
(2)数据挖掘:采用数据挖掘技术,从海量数据中提取有价值的信息。
(3)机器学习:采用机器学习技术,实现智能推荐、预测等功能。
3、安全防护技术
安全防护技术为大型网络服务器平台提供了安全保障,以抵御各种安全威胁,主要技术包括:
(1)入侵检测与防御:采用入侵检测与防御技术,及时发现并阻止恶意攻击。
(2)漏洞扫描:定期进行漏洞扫描,及时发现和修复系统漏洞。
(3)安全审计:对系统进行安全审计,确保系统安全稳定运行。
大型网络服务器平台在保障网络稳定运行、提升服务质量等方面具有重要意义,本文对大型网络服务器平台的架构、功能以及关键技术进行了详细解析,旨在为相关从业人员提供有益的参考,随着技术的不断发展,大型网络服务器平台将不断创新,为我国互联网事业的发展贡献力量。
本文链接:https://www.zhitaoyun.cn/162846.html
发表评论